摘 要:铁道电气化接触网硬点问题是铁道电气化建设的常见问题之一,此类问题容易产生电弧伤害以及机械损伤问题。解决此问题,一直都将是铁道接触网的关键性工作。下面将以铁道电气化接触网硬点问题为研究对象,主要探讨电气化接触网、接触网硬点问题和危害、接触网硬点产生原因以及硬点改进对策,结合我国铁道接触网建设实际情况,从理论和实践两个方面总结铁道电气化接触网硬点改进对策,旨在推动我国铁道电气化接触网发展。The problem of hard points in the overhead contact system of railway electrification is one of the common problems in railway electrification construction,which is prone to the problems of electric arc damage and mechanical damage,and solving this problem will always be a key task for the overhead contact system of railways.This article will take the problem of hard points in the overhead contact system of railway electrification as the research object,mainly discuss the electrified overhead contact system,the problems and hazards of hard points in the overhead contact system,the causes of hard points in the overhead contact system,and the improvement measures for hard points,and summarizes the improvement measures for hard points in the overhead contact system of railway electrification from both theoretical and practical aspects in combination with the actual situation of the construction of the overhead contact system of railways in China,aiming to promote the development of the overhead contact system of railway electrification in China.
